@keyframes ticker{0%{transform:translateX(0)}to{transform:translateX(-50%)}}@keyframes ticker2{0%{transform:translateX(-45%)}to{transform:translateX(0)}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es spinner-loader{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.wp-lightbox-container button:not(:hover):not(:active):not(.has-background){background-color:#5a5a5a40;border:0}.wp-lightbox-overlay .close-button:not(:hover):not(:active):not(.has-background){background:0 0;border:0}ul{box-sizing:border-box}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}[placeholder]:focus::-webkit-input-placeholder{-webkit-transition:opacity .5s .5s;transition:opacity .5s .5s;opacity:1!important}.wpcf7 .screen-reader-response{position:absolute;overflow:hidden;clip:rect(1px,1px,1px,1px);clip-path:inset(50%);height:1px;width:1px;margin:-1px;padding:0;border:0;word-wrap:normal!important}.wpcf7 form .wpcf7-response-output{margin:2em .5em 1em;padding:.2em 1em;border:2px solid #00a0d2}.wpcf7 form.init .wpcf7-response-output{display:none}.wpcf7-form-control-wrap{position:relative}.wpcf7-list-item{display:inline-block;margin:0 0 0 1em}.wpcf7-list-item-label:after,.wpcf7-list-item-label:before{content:" "}.wpcf7 .wpcf7-submit:disabled{cursor:not-allowed}.wpcf7 input[type=tel]{direction:ltr}body,html{border:0;font:inherit;vertical-align:baseline}a,div,footer,form,h1,h2,h3,h4,header,img,label,li,p,section,span,strong,ul{margin:0;padding:0;border:0;font:inherit;vertical-align:baseline}html{scroll-behavior:smooth}*,body,html{margin:0;padding:0}body,html{overflow-x:hidden}body{font-style:normal;line-height:26px;color:#3e2b24;font-weight:500;background-color:#f1f1f1;background:url(/wp-content/themes/PulseNew/assets/img/main-bg.png)}*{box-sizing:border-box}@font-face{font-display:swap;font-family:"DrukWideCyr";src:url(/wp-content/themes/PulseNew/assets/fonts/drukwidecyr-bold.otf)format("opentype");font-weight:700;font-style:normal}@font-face{font-display:swap;font-family:"DrukWideCyr";src:url(/wp-content/themes/PulseNew/assets/fonts/drukwidecyr-heavy.otf)format("opentype");font-weight:900;font-style:normal}@font-face{font-display:swap;font-family:"DrukWideCyr";src:url(/wp-content/themes/PulseNew/assets/fonts/drukwidecyr-medium.otf)format("opentype");font-weight:500;font-style:normal}@font-face{font-display:swap;font-family:"DrukWideCyr";src:url(/wp-content/themes/PulseNew/assets/fonts/drukwidecyr-super.otf)format("opentype");font-weight:1000;font-style:normal}footer,header,section{display:block}a,body,button{font-size:16px}button{transition:.2s}a{text-decoration:none;color:#1c1c1c;line-height:26px}a,body,h1,h2,h3,h4{font-family:"Montserrat",sans-serif}a:hover{transition:.2s;text-decoration:underline}ul li{list-style-type:none}.container{max-width:1440px;margin:0 auto}.header-wrapper{display:flex;justify-content:space-between}.header-left{display:flex;gap:25px;align-items:center}.btn-wrapper{display:flex;max-width:320px}.btn,.btn-primary{background-color:#1c1c1c;color:#fff;border-radius:50px;transition:all .5s;border:1px solid #1c1c1c}.btn{padding:11px 15px;font-family:"Montserrat",sans-serif;font-size:16px;font-weight:500;line-height:26px}.btn-wrapper:hover .btn,.btn-wrapper:hover .btn-primary,.btn:hover{background-color:transparent;color:#1c1c1c}.btn-primary{padding:11px 19px}.btn-wrapper:hover .btn-primary{rotate:180deg}.arrow-white{fill:#fff}.btn-wrapper:hover .btn-primary svg{fill:#000}.header-right{display:flex;gap:25px;width:55%;align-items:center;justify-content:flex-end}.lang-wrapper{gap:10px}.lang-wrapper a{color:#1c1c1c80}.lang-wrapper .active-lang{color:#1c1c1c;text-decoration:underline}.btn-open,.menu__phone{display:none}.btn-white{background-color:#fff;color:#1c1c1c;border:1px solid #fff}.btn-wrapper:hover .btn-white{background-color:transparent;color:#fff!important}.single-blog__header h1{font-family:"DrukWideCyr";font-weight:500;font-size:64px;line-height:78px;text-transform:capitalize}span{color:#f14f44}strong{font-family:"DrukWideCyr";font-weight:700}.marquee{margin-top:75px}.ticker{background:#f14f44;color:#000;font-family:"Montserrat",sans-serif;font-size:24px;max-width:100%;overflow:hidden}.marquee-two{background:#1c1c1c;rotate:1.5deg}.marquee-two span,.reviews h3,.reviews h4{color:#fff}.ticker__in{display:flex;width:fit-content;animation:ticker 20s linear infinite}.marquee-two .ticker__in{animation:ticker2 20s linear infinite}.ticker__item{padding:.5em .75em;white-space:nowrap;color:#1c1c1c;-webkit-backface-visibility:hidden}.section-title{font-family:"DrukWideCyr";font-size:36px;font-weight:500;line-height:46px;margin-top:25px;margin-bottom:50px;text-transform:capitalize}.project-link{width:100%;max-width:750px}.project-wrapp{position:relative}.project-tags{position:absolute;top:0;display:flex;gap:5px;margin-left:25px;margin-top:25px}.project-tags a{font-size:14px;line-height:24px;background-color:#fff;padding:5px 15px;border-radius:50px}.footer-contacts p,.project-title{font-family:"DrukWideCyr";font-weight:500}.project-title{font-size:18px;line-height:28px;text-transform:capitalize}#section-margin{margin-top:100px}.reviews{background-color:#1c1c1c;padding:100px 0}.footer{padding:100px 0 0}.footer-contacts{display:flex;justify-content:space-between;margin-top:50px}.footer-contacts p{color:#fff;font-size:24px}.footer-contacts a{font-size:16px;line-height:26px;color:#fff}.footer-left{width:480px}.footer-icons{display:flex;gap:15px}.footer-bottom{background-color:#fff;border-radius:25px 25px 0 0;width:100%;padding:32px 0;text-align:center;margin-top:100px}.footer-wrapper{display:flex;justify-content:space-between}.form-wrapper{background-color:#2f2f2f;padding:50px;border-radius:50px;border:1px solid #4b4b4b}.form-desk,.form-title{color:#fff;font-weight:500}.form-title{font-family:"DrukWideCyr";font-size:36px;line-height:46px}.form-desk{margin-top:25px;margin-bottom:50px;font-size:20px;line-height:30px}.form-field{width:100%;background-color:#2f2f2f;border:0;border-bottom:1px solid #fff}input[type=checkbox],input[type=tel],input[type=text],textarea{-moz-box-sizing:border-box;box-sizing:border-box;outline:0!important;color:#fff}input[type=tel],input[type=text],textarea{height:2.857em;-webkit-transition:all .3s;transition:all .3s;background:0 0;border-width:0 0 1px;border-style:none none solid;padding:0 0 12px;width:100%;display:block;min-height:40px;margin:20px 0 0}.wpcf7-list-item-label{color:#fff;font-family:"Montserrat";font-style:normal;font-weight:400;font-size:16px}.wpcf7-checkbox{display:flex;gap:20px}input[type=checkbox]{border:1px solid #fff;background-color:transparent;width:20px;height:20px;-webkit-border-radius:5px;border-radius:5px;display:inline-block!important;margin:0 10px 0 0;cursor:pointer;vertical-align:text-top;position:relative;-webkit-appearance:none;-moz-appearance:none;appearance:none}input[type=checkbox]:checked:before{content:"✔";position:absolute;width:20px;height:20px;text-align:center;display:block;z-index:2;left:0;right:0;top:0}textarea{overflow:hidden}.form-bottom{display:flex;margin-top:50px;gap:30px;align-items:center;justify-content:space-between}.form-bottom a,.form-bottom p{color:#fff;font-family:"Montserrat";font-style:normal;font-weight:400;font-size:14px;line-height:24px}.form-bottom p{max-width:360px}.form-bottom a{text-decoration:underline}.wpcf7-submit{padding:12px 90px;background-color:#fff;color:#1c1c1c;border-radius:50px;font-family:"Montserrat",sans-serif;font-size:16px;font-weight:500;line-height:26px;transition:all .5s;width:100%;border:1px solid #fff}.wpcf7-submit:hover{background-color:transparent;color:#fff}::-webkit-scrollbar{width:10px}::-webkit-scrollbar-track{box-shadow:inset 0 0 5px gray;border-radius:10px}::-webkit-scrollbar-thumb{background:#f14f44;border-radius:10px}.fade-in-up{animation:fadeInUp 1s ease-in-out;opacity:0;transform:translateY(20px);transition:opacity 1s ease-in-out,transform 1s ease-in-out}.section-about{text-transform:capitalize}.single-first{margin-top:100px}.single-head__wrapper{display:flex}.blog-item{width:460px;height:250px;background-size:cover;background-position:center center;background-repeat:no-repeat;border-radius:25px}.blog-btn{position:absolute;right:20px;top:185px;transition:all 1s}.blog-info .project-title{min-height:55px;margin:15px 0}.blog-desk{margin-top:25px}.lang-wrapper{display:flex!important}header .menu-item a{white-space:nowrap}#menu-header-menu-english{display:flex;gap:25px;align-items:center}@media (max-width:1460px){.header-right{width:auto}.container{padding:0 10px}.blog-item{width:100%}}@media (max-width:1320px){.telegram-btn{display:none}.footer-left{width:420px}.footer-wrapper{gap:40px}.form-title{font-size:28px}}@media (max-width:1200px){.form-wrapper{padding:40px}.footer-contacts{justify-content:space-between;margin-top:25px;flex-direction:column;gap:25px}}@media (max-width:1185px){header .menu-item a{font-size:14px}#menu-header-menu-english{display:flex;gap:15px}.single-blog__header h1{font-size:48px;line-height:54px}.blog-desk{margin-top:15px}}@media (max-width:1080px){.form-bottom{flex-direction:column;align-items:flex-start}.form-bottom p{max-width:100%}.form-title{font-size:24px}.form-desk{margin-top:15px;margin-bottom:30px;font-size:16px;line-height:26px}}@media (max-width:1040px){.single-first{margin-top:50px}.lang-wrapper,.telegram-btn{display:block}.header-right,.menu-wrapper{display:none}.menu__phone{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:end;-ms-flex-align:end;align-items:start;background:#1c1c1c;gap:14px;position:fixed;right:-100%;top:0;bottom:0;height:100%;padding:70px 16px 0 15px;transition:.5s;width:365px}.menu li{margin-bottom:15px;padding:0 12px}.btn-open{display:block}.btn-close{position:absolute;top:25px;right:15px}.lang-wrapper a{color:#ffffff59}.mobmenu-bottom{padding:0 12px}.lang-wrapper{display:flex}.mobmenu-wrapp{margin-top:25px}.lang-wrapper .active-lang,.menu li a,.telegram-btn a{color:#fff}.telegram-btn{margin:25px 0}.footer-wrapper{flex-direction:column}.footer{padding-top:50px}.footer-left{width:100%}.footer-contacts{flex-direction:row;margin-top:30px}}@media (max-width:780px){.single__post-slider{margin-top:25px}.single-head__wrapper{flex-direction:column}.section-title{margin-bottom:10px;font-size:26px;line-height:28px}.reviews{padding:50px 0}.footer{padding:50px 0 0}.footer-bottom{margin-top:50px;padding:15px 0}}@media (max-width:600px){.blog-info .project-title{min-height:0;margin:10px 0}.blog-info .project-type{font-size:12px;line-height:18px}}@media (max-width:550px){.header-wrapper{margin-top:25px;align-items:center}.logo-wrapper a img{width:auto;height:70px}.form-bottom div,.form-bottom p{width:100%}.form-field{border-radius:0}body{overflow-x:hidden}.footer-contacts p,.section-about{font-size:14px}#section-margin{margin-top:50px}.project-wrapp{width:100%}.section-title{font-size:18px;line-height:28px;margin-top:15px}.form-title,.project-title,.project-type{font-size:16px;line-height:26px}.project-tags a{font-size:12px;line-height:24px;background-color:#fff;padding:0 12px;border-radius:50px}.form-desk{font-size:14px;line-height:24px}.footer-icons a img{max-width:35px}.form-wrapper{padding:25px;border-radius:25px}input[type=tel],input[type=text],textarea{margin:0;min-height:20px}.footer-contacts a,.wpcf7-list-item-label{font-size:14px}.wpcf7-list-item{margin:0}.form-bottom{margin-top:25px}.single-blog__header h1{font-size:26px;line-height:38px}}@media (max-width:420px){.project-tags a{font-size:10px;padding:0 8px}.menu__phone{width:320px}.mobmenu-bottom .btn-wrapper .btn{padding:5px 10px;font-size:12px}.footer-bottom a,.footer-bottom p{font-size:12px}}@media (max-width:410px){input[type=checkbox]{margin:0 3px 0 0}.pum-close{right:10px!important}}@media (max-width:390px){.form-wrapper{padding:17px}.pum-close{right:4px!important;top:-10px!important}}@media (max-width:375px){.project-tags{display:none}.form-wrapper{padding:17px}.form-title{font-size:14px}}@font-face{font-display:swap;font-family:"slick";font-weight:400;font-style:normal;src:url(/wp-content/themes/PulseNew/assets/css/fonts/slick.eot);src:url(/wp-content/themes/PulseNew/assets/css/fonts/slick.eot?#iefix)format("embedded-opentype"),url(/wp-content/themes/PulseNew/assets/css/fonts/slick.woff)format("woff"),url(/wp-content/themes/PulseNew/assets/css/fonts/slick.ttf)format("truetype"),url(/wp-content/themes/PulseNew/assets/css/fonts/slick.svg#slick)format("svg")}.pum-container,.pum-content,.pum-content+.pum-close,.pum-content+.pum-close:active,.pum-content+.pum-close:focus,.pum-content+.pum-close:hover,.pum-overlay{background:0 0;border:0;bottom:auto;clear:none;cursor:default;float:none;font-family:inherit;font-size:medium;font-style:normal;font-weight:400;height:auto;left:auto;letter-spacing:normal;line-height:normal;max-height:none;max-width:none;min-height:0;min-width:0;overflow:visible;position:static;right:auto;text-align:left;text-decoration:none;text-indent:0;text-transform:none;top:auto;visibility:visible;white-space:normal;width:auto;z-index:auto}.pum-content{position:relative;z-index:1}.pum-overlay{position:fixed;height:100%;width:100%;top:0;left:0;right:0;bottom:0;z-index:1999999999;overflow:initial;display:none;transition:.15s ease-in-out}.pum-overlay,.pum-overlay *,.pum-overlay :after,.pum-overlay :before,.pum-overlay:after,.pum-overlay:before{box-sizing:border-box}.pum-container{top:100px;position:absolute;margin-bottom:3em;z-index:1999999999}.pum-container.pum-responsive{left:50%;margin-left:-47.5%;width:95%;height:auto;overflow:visible}@media only screen and (min-width:1024px){.pum-container.pum-responsive.pum-responsive-medium{margin-left:-30%;width:60%}}.pum-container .pum-content>:last-child{margin-bottom:0}.pum-container .pum-content:focus{outline:0}.pum-container .pum-content>:first-child{margin-top:0}.pum-container .pum-content+.pum-close{text-decoration:none;text-align:center;line-height:1;position:absolute;cursor:pointer;min-width:1em;z-index:2;background-color:transparent}.popmake-close{cursor:pointer}.pum-sub-form .spinner-loader:not(:required){animation:1.5s linear infinite spinner-loader;border-radius:.5em;box-shadow:rgba(0,0,51,.3) 1.5em 0 0 0,rgba(0,0,51,.3) 1.1em 1.1em 0 0,rgba(0,0,51,.3)0 1.5em 0 0,rgba(0,0,51,.3) -1.1em 1.1em 0 0,rgba(0,0,51,.3) -1.5em 0 0 0,rgba(0,0,51,.3) -1.1em -1.1em 0 0,rgba(0,0,51,.3)0-1.5em 0 0,rgba(0,0,51,.3) 1.1em -1.1em 0 0;display:inline-block;font-size:10px;width:1em;height:1em;margin:1.5em;overflow:hidden;text-indent:100%}.pum-theme-182,.pum-theme-lightbox{background-color:rgba(0,0,0,.6)}.pum-theme-182 .pum-container,.pum-theme-lightbox .pum-container{padding:1px;border-radius:50px;border:8px #000;box-shadow:0 0 30px 0#020202;background-color:#2f2f2f}.pum-theme-182 .pum-content,.pum-theme-lightbox .pum-content{color:#000;font-family:inherit;font-weight:100}.pum-theme-182 .pum-content+.pum-close,.pum-theme-lightbox .pum-content+.pum-close{position:absolute;height:25px;width:40px;left:auto;right:20px;bottom:auto;top:10px;padding:15px;color:#fff;font-family:Montserrat;font-weight:500;font-size:30px;line-height:24px;border:2px #fff;border-radius:26px;box-shadow:0 0 15px 1px transparent;text-shadow:0 0 0 transparent;background-color:transparent}